Reusable Validations for Power Pages Development: Code Once, Use Everywhere (Part 1)

Reusable Validations for Power Pages Development: Code Once, Use Everywhere (Part 1)
Validating user input is one of the most important — yet often overlooked — aspects of Power Pages development. Whether you’re building a public-facing portal, a secure partner site, or an internal knowledge hub, ensuring accurate, complete, and accessible data entry is critical.
